Crucial Functions of a Registered Agent

A registered agent serves a key role in sustaining the conformity and official standing of a enterprise. One of the foremost responsibilities of a registered agent is to accept government documents on behalf of the enterprise. This includes legal papers, tax notifications, and other official correspondence. Having a trustworthy registered agent ensures that vital documents are promptly dispatched and processed, preventing any negative consequences that may arise from missed notifications.

In addition to get documents, a registered agent is charged with maintaining accurate records of all communications and official notices obtained. This record-keeping is crucial for demonstrating compliance with state regulations and can be important in legal situations. A seasoned registered agent will also provide reminders for important reporting deadlines, such as yearly filings and renewal alerts, helping businesses avoid sanctions or diminution of good standing.

Another important responsibility of a registered agent is to confirm compliance with state-specific legal requirements. Each jurisdiction has its own regulations regarding registered agents, including filing fees and periodic requirements. A knowledgeable registered agent will manage these requirements effectively, helping businesses understand their responsibilities and ensuring they remain within the law. As such, picking the right registered agent is crucial for entrepreneurs looking to secure their enterprise's business integrity and legal compliance.

Importance of Adherence and Regulatory Obligations

Adherence with legal requirements is a crucial aspect of upholding a commercial entity, such as an Limited Liability Company or corporate entity. A designated representative plays a critical role in this process by making sure that all official documents, tax notices, and judicial notices are received and handled properly. Neglect to adhere with legal obligations can lead to severe repercussions, including fines, legal penalties, and even the termination of the entity. Thus, selecting a reliable agent provider is imperative for maintaining compliance.

A professional designated representative is responsible for staying updated on the legal requirements specific to the jurisdiction where the business is incorporated. This includes being aware of the filing deadlines for yearly filings, franchise taxes, and other required documentation. Opting for a designated representative who provides compliance monitoring services can reduce the responsibility on business owners, allowing them to concentrate on their core operations while ensuring that their legal responsibilities are met promptly.
